After applying the linear combination method, Heather arrived at the equation 0 = 60. What conclusion can be drawn about the sys

tem of equations? The equation has no solution; therefore, the system of equations has no solution. The equation has a solution at (0, 60); therefore, the system of equations has a solution at (0, 60). The equation has infinite solutions; therefore, the system of equation as infinite solutions. The equation has a solution at (0, 0); therefore, the system of equations has a solution at (0, 0).
Mathematics
1 answer:
liq [111]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The correct answer is:

The equation has no solution; therefore, the system of equations has no solution.

Step-by-step explanation:

When solving a system of equations, after we combine the equations, if we find that there is no solution, that means that there is no solution to the entire system of equations.

In a particular week a man receives 909.50 but 229.50 was for a overtime. If he works a basic week of 40 hours and overtime is p
Airida [17]
Total salary = 909.50
Out of this, overtime salary was = 229.50

Normal salary for 40 hours was = 909.50 - 229.50 = 680

Hourly rate = 680/40 = 17

Overtime is time and half = 17 + 17/2 = 17 + 8.5 = 25.5

Number of overtime hours = 229.50/25.5 = 9 hours

Help?. . What is the equation of the function y=5/x translated 4 units to the left and 3 units up?. . I don't even know where to
Dahasolnce [82]
Y = 5/x
If you want to shift the function 4 units left, you can add 4 to the x-value in the parent function:
y = 5 / ( x + 4 )
After that, you can add 3 to your function to shift it up 3 units.
y = 5 /( x + 4 )  + 3 ( the final equation )
